What should you know about retinol?

It is a derivative of vitamin A belonging to the retinoid family, which can be classified into different groups based on its components, distinguishing their effectiveness. This is an ingredient long recommended by dermatologists, clinically proven to stimulate collagen production, reduce wrinkles, and fade pigmentation spots. It is also proven effective in fighting acne.

Retinoic Acid

This is an active molecule that stimulates skin cells to produce collagen, thereby slowing down skin aging. The anti-aging effect of retinoic acid is backed by significant clinical experience, making it the only FDA-approved and clinically proven effective anti-aging ingredient.

Retinol

Pure vitamin A itself, which is inactive until it is converted into retinoic acid by enzymes in the skin. It exerts its skin-rejuvenating effect during this transformation.

Retinal

This ingredient can convert into retinoic acid up to ten times more effectively because it initiates the process in a single step. Being a gentler ingredient, it causes less skin irritation but is more effective and visible in reducing wrinkles!

Bioretinol - Bakuchiol (which is actually not retinol)

A plant-based ingredient that works similarly to retinol on the skin but, based on its chemical and structural components, does not belong to the retinol family. It is an excellent retinol substitute and an anti-aging alternative that often replaces retinol.

What is retinol good for?

  • Reducing wrinkles and fine lines: Stimulates collagen production in the skin, resulting in firmer and smoother skin.
  • Fading pigmentation spots: Helps reduce sun-induced pigmentation and results in a more even skin tone.
  • Fighting acne: Regulates sebum production, thereby reducing the likelihood of clogged pores and inflammation.
  • Stimulating cell renewal: Accelerates cell turnover, making the skin look fresher and healthier.

How to incorporate retinol into your daily Korean skincare routine?

  • Start with a low concentration! - If you have never used a retinol serum before, choose a product with a lower concentration (e.g., 0.1%).
  • Use only at night! - Retinol is sensitive to sunlight, so it is best to include it in your evening routine.
  • Use sunscreen during the day! - Retinol makes the skin sensitive to light, so always use at least SPF 30 sunscreen during the day.
  • Be patient! - Its effects are not immediate; noticeable results usually appear after 6-12 weeks of regular use.
